A BILL
To amend the Agricultural Act of 2014 with respect to the tree
assistance program, and for other purposes.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the
United States of America in Congress assembled,
SECTION 1. SHORT TITLE.
This Act may be cited as the ``Protecting America's Orchardists and
Nursery Tree Growers Act''.
SEC. 2. TREE ASSISTANCE PROGRAM.
(a) Definitions.--Section 1501(e)(1) of the Agricultural Act of
2014 (7 U.S.C. 9081(e)(1)) is amended--
(1) in subparagraph (A), by inserting ``or biennial'' after
``annual''; and
(2) in subparagraph (B), by inserting ``or pest'' after
``insect''.
(b) Lowering Mortality Threshold.--Section 1501(e) of the
Agricultural Act of 2014 (7 U.S.C. 9081(e)) is amended--
(1) in paragraph (2)(B), by striking ``15 percent (adjusted
for normal mortality)'' and inserting ``normal mortality'';
(2) in paragraph (3)(A)(i), by striking ``15 percent
mortality (adjusted for normal mortality)'' and inserting
``normal mortality''; and
(3) in paragraph (3)(B), by striking ``15 percent damage or
mortality (adjusted for normal tree damage and mortality'' and
inserting ``normal tree damage or mortality''.
(c) Assistance.--Section 1501(e)(3) of the Agricultural Act of 2014
(7 U.S.C. 9081(e)(3)) is amended in the matter before subparagraph (A)
by striking ``and (5)'' and inserting ``(5), and (6)''.
(d) Requirements With Respect to Assistance.--Section 1501(e) of
the Agricultural Act of 2014 (7 U.S.C. 9081(e)) is amended by adding at
the end the following:
``(6) Timing requirements.--An eligible orchardist or
nursery tree grower shall agree, as a condition on receipt of
assistance under this subsection, to carry out any replacement
and rehabilitation activities for which such assistance is
provided not later than--
``(A) 12 months after the application for such
assistance is approved; or
``(B) if the period specified in subparagraph (A)
is not adequate for tree survival, at such time as is
necessary to ensure tree survival.
``(7) Alternatives used in replanting.--
``(A) In general.--An eligible orchardist or
nursery tree grower receiving assistance under this
subsection with respect to tree loss may use such
assistance to replant using--
``(i) an alternative variety;
``(ii) an alternative stand density; and
``(iii) an alternative location than was
used prior to the loss.
``(B) Limitations with respect to alternatives.--
The assistance provided by the Secretary to eligible
orchardists and nursery tree growers--
``(i) for losses described in subparagraph
(A)(i), may not be greater than the amount the
eligible orchardist or nursery tree grower
would receive if the eligible orchardist or
nursery tree grower planted the variety lost;
``(ii) for losses described in subparagraph
(A)(ii) may not be greater than the amount the
eligible orchardist or nursery tree grower
would receive if the eligible orchardist or
nursery tree grower planted the stand density
lost; and
``(iii) for losses described in
subparagraph (A)(iii), may not be greater than
the amount the eligible orchardist or nursery
tree grower would receive if the eligible
orchardist or nursery tree grower planted the
location in which the loss occurred.''.
(e) Exclusion of Gross Income Limitation.--Section 1501(e) of the
Agricultural Act of 2014 (7 U.S.C. 9801(e)) is further amended by
adding at the end the following:
``(8) Exclusion of gross income limitation.--Subsection (b)
of section 1001D of the Food Security Act of 1985 (7 U.S.C.
1308-3a) shall not apply with respect to assistance under this
subsection made to a person or legal entity that has an average
adjusted gross income (as defined in such section) of which 75
percent or greater derives from farming, ranching, or
silviculture activities.''.
(f) Notice of Application Status.--Section 1501(e) of the
Agricultural Act of 2014 (7 U.S.C. 9801(e)) is further amended by
adding at the end the following:
``(9) Notice of application status.--Not later than 120
days after receiving an application for assistance under this
subsection, the Secretary shall--
``(A) approve or deny such application; and
``(B) notify the applicant of such approval or
denial.''.
